Foulbec

Tree ID: 1329

Yews recorded: Ancient 7m+

Tree girth: 823cm

Girth height: not recorded

Tree sex: Female

Date of visit: 9-Aug-00

Source of earliest mention: 1868: Annuaire des cinq departements de l’ancienne Normandie

Notes:

August 2000 – Tim Hills: Five huge branches radiate from this hollowing bole. A 6th, now a hollowed out shell, remains to remind us of the tree’s former glory. The notice by the tree gives it an age between 900 and 1300 years.
Wim Peeters: The yew is referred to on p138 of the 1868 Annuaire des cinq departements de l’ancienne Normandie, Par Association Normande, Association normande pour le progres de l’agriculture, de l’ industrie, des sciences et des arts. ‘The church is always shaded by its famous yew, talked about by the scientist Rever in his Voyage des eleves des ecole centrale de l’Eure pendant les vacances de l’an VIII (Travels of the students of the central school of the Eure, during its vacations of the year VIII), p. 136. It was 21 feet around in its central part, a girth which had not significantly increased.
